Sounds like classic bypass valve symptoms (especially the first 2 points). Water pump tends to drip, but not smell as noticeably in the cabin being not as close to the cabin air intake. Heater core would not tend to leave puddles as you describe -- coolant would be trapped in the airbox or drip out the condensate drains
Check the steady lines of liquid to see what they are -- they may be A/C condensate -- when I back out of the garage, I leave a trail of drips as well from the drains that are under the car (roughly beneath the front seats).
Search the board for lots of advice on removing the bypass valve and replacing it with hoses, which many have done quite successfully. Or you can just replace the valve, and it will fail again in a couple of years.
